Using Facebook to build a community in the Conjunto Arqueológico de Carmona (Seville, Spain) 使用Facebook在卡莫纳(西班牙塞维利亚)建立社区
Q3 Arts and Humanities Pub Date : 2017-01-06 DOI: 10.23914/AP.V4I0.44
I. Temiño, D. Acuña
When the Conjunto Arqueologico de Carmona (Seville) was inaugurated as the first open-air archaeological museum in Spain in 1885, the institution enjoyed a local community of people interested in archaeology, but this community lost strength over time. One hundred years later, the institution has the goal of being a participative museum, and rekindling a special relationship with the local population, to form a new community of users which complements visitors. This article presents the preliminary results of a descriptive and exploratory study involving Facebook use to find out the demographic characteristics of people interested in the Conjunto Arqueologico de Carmona, as previous research to form a local community interested in archaeology and cultural heritage. Special attention is paid to the role played by education through archaeology as a means to improve social empowerment.

Lies, damned lies, and archaeologists: antiquities trafficking research as criminology and the ethics of identification 谎言,该死的谎言和考古学家:作为犯罪学和身份伦理学的文物贩运研究
Q3 Arts and Humanities Pub Date : 2017-01-06 DOI: 10.23914/AP.V4I2.57
D. Yates
By definition, our interactions with those that we consider to be ‘extradisciplinary’ are predicated on our own self-identification as archaeologists. It isn’t news that some stakeholders react negatively to archaeologists. To them, we are not neutral, well-meaning stewards of the past, but rather a competing group that doesn’t compromise and stifles dissent by claiming a mandate on defining ‘the public good’. How can I effectively engage with such groups when my identity as an archaeologist is unforgivable? Perhaps the archaeologist must leave archaeology. This paper is about transitioning from a PhD in archaeology to a post doctoral fellowship in a criminology department. As part of the University of Glasgow’s Trafficking Culture project, I study the looting of archaeological sites and the illicit trafficking of cultural property. For half a century archaeologists have clashed with antiquities intermediaries, collectors, and dealers leaving wounds and scars on both sides. These folks will not engage with an ‘archaeologist’, but they are willing to talk to a ‘sociologist’ or even a ‘criminologist’ which is how I now present myself. This paper will focus on the ethical issues of disciplinary labelling. What are the primary benefits of presenting myself as ‘extra-archaeological’? Of not asserting archaeological expertise? Am I obliged to reveal my archaeological background? Does this change of discipline have a tangible effect on the research that I conduct? Do I protect cultural property or protect informants? Am I still an archaeologist?

Sustainability in community archaeology 社区考古的可持续性
Q3 Arts and Humanities Pub Date : 2017-01-06 DOI: 10.23914/AP.V4I2.58
P. Belford
This paper considers the rise of community archaeology in England and Wales, its relationships with other branches of archaeology, and its longterm sustainability. Possible meanings of sustainability are discussed from an international and interdisciplinary perspective, before questions of social, intellectual and economic sustainability in community archaeology are considered. It is argued that true sustainability for community archaeology will only be possible if research outcomes and public benefit are considered as being of equal value.
